Ostrowski quotients for finite extensions of number fields

Ehsan Shahoseini, Ali Rajaei and Abbas Maarefparvar

Vol. 321 (2022), No. 2, 415–429
Abstract

For LK, a finite Galois extension of number fields, the relative Pólya group Po (LK) coincides with the group of strongly ambiguous ideal classes in LK. In this paper, using a well-known exact sequence related to Po (LK) from the works of Brumer and Rosen (1963) and Zantema (1982), we find short proofs for some classical results in the literature. Then we define the Ostrowski quotient Ost (LK) as the cokernel of the capitulation map into Po (LK) and generalize some known results for Po (L) to Ost (LK).
